I implemented changes in DBCP, based on recently committed changes in
pool. I made a few decisions that I would appreciate feedback on.
1. The JDBC abort method requires an Executor as actual parameter. I
added a FixedThreadPool executor with a max of 3 threads to
PoolableConnectionFactory for this purpose. Given that this operation
might hang sometimes, I thought it best to allow more than a single
thread. I guess it could be configurable, but 3 seemed a reasonable
choice. I copied the custom thread factory used by pool's EvictionTimer
to source daemon threads based on ccl for this. I then added a close()
method to PCF that closes the executor and modified BasicDataSource
close to call this.
2. I used p.getObject().getInnermostDelegate().abort(executor) in PCF
destroyObject when abandoned mode is passed in rather than just
getObject().abort as destroy invokes close (I wonder if that is a bug?)
3. I changed JdbcBridge#abort to remove the checkOpen() check. I was
getting exceptions in my concurrency tests where connections were being
closed but then considered abandoned. This is a legit race that abort
will generally handle fine and I don't see the need to throw.

On one hand if the driver deadlocks I don't see how that can be anything
other than a driver bug. If multiple code paths obtain multiple locks
then those code paths must always obtain those locks in the same order.
Anything else is a bug that is likely to result in a deadlock in a
multithreaded environment.
On the other hand, it could be argued that the situation only arises
when an application doesn't correctly return connections to the pool
and/or keeps them for too long and/or doesn't configure the pool
correctly for their usage pattern.
The approach of adding
PooledObjectFactory.destroyObject(PooledObject,CloseMode)
where CloseMode is an Enum with two values looks reasonable to me.
I have started to work on the [pool] changes for this. I want to check
two things before completing the PR:
1. "Close" is a [dbcp] concept which does not make sense for all pool
factories, so I am going to name the enum "DestroyMode" and the two
modes, "Default" and "Abandoned". That leaves room for other modes like
"Evicted" or "Invalid" later.
2. Speaking of later, technically adding modes will not break binary
compatibility. Are we going to be OK adding outside a major release?
If the answer is no, I might argue to include the other natural modes now.
Yes, IMO, it is OK to add enum values in a minor release since it does
not break binary (or source) compatibility.
